New Mela Aqua Seal System Enhances Postoperative Drainage Safety

New Mela Aqua Seal System Enhances Postoperative Drainage Safety

2025-12-23

Postoperative drainage management presents significant challenges in thoracic and abdominal surgeries, with risks of infection, backflow, and inefficient fluid removal. The Mera Aqua Seal® drainage bag, developed by Izumi Medical Industry Co., Ltd., addresses these concerns through its patented water-seal design and multi-layered safety mechanisms.

Product Overview

The Mera Aqua Seal® is a single-use medical device designed for post-surgical drainage of blood, gases, and exudates from thoracic or abdominal cavities. Its water-seal technology prevents air reflux while maintaining consistent negative pressure during drainage procedures.

Key Features
  • Water-Seal Technology: A maintained water column creates a physical barrier against air reflux into patient cavities, significantly reducing infection risks.
  • Dual Safety Valves: Integrated backflow prevention and overflow protection valves ensure system integrity during both gravity drainage and active suction.
  • Dual-Port Configuration (2000ml model): Allows simultaneous connection of two drainage circuits for complex surgical cases requiring multi-site management.
  • Precision Graduations: Clear milliliter markings enable accurate fluid output monitoring for clinical assessment.
  • Medical-Grade Materials: Manufactured with biocompatible polymers to minimize allergic reactions.
Technical Specifications
Model Capacity Graduation Backflow Valve
D2 Type 1000ml 5ml/10ml increments No
2000 Type 2000ml 5ml/10ml increments No
D2 Type (with valve) 1000ml 5ml/10ml increments Yes
2000 Type (with valve) 2000ml 5ml/10ml increments Yes
Clinical Applications
  • Post-thoracotomy drainage
  • Abdominal surgical drainage
  • Management of other surgical wound exudates
Operational Considerations
  • The actual negative pressure at the patient interface will be approximately 2hPa less than the set pressure due to water-seal resistance.
  • For thoracic drainage, the backflow prevention valve must remain connected when disengaging suction apparatus.
  • Regular monitoring of water-seal evaporation and foam formation is essential for maintaining system efficacy.
Compatibility

The device interfaces with Izumi Medical's Mera Suction systems (MS-008, MS-008EX, and MS-009 models) and proprietary connector tubing.

Storage and Stability

Unopened units should be stored in dry conditions away from direct sunlight. The in-use duration should not exceed seven days post-activation.
